A pulse oximeter works by analyzing the amount of oxygen in your blood using two small sensors that are placed on your fingertip. The device then calculates your SpO2 level, which is a percentage representing the amount of hemoglobin in your red blood cells that is bound to oxygen.

Regular pulse oximetry assessment can be particularly helpful for individuals with underlying health conditions such as asthma. By detecting potential declines in oxygen levels, you can take necessary actions to manage your condition and improve your overall well-being.

Tracking Your Health: Pulse Oximeters for Home Use

In today's careful world, having access to your vital signs at home has increased. Pulse oximeters offer a simple and budget-friendly solution for tracking your blood oxygen levels. These portable devices utilize LEDs to measure the percentage of oxygen in your body. A reading of 95% or above is generally considered ideal, while lower readings may indicate underlying health conditions.
